Job overview

We are seeking a highly motivated and committed primary specialist for Year 1, who will identify with and promote the school's high standards of teaching and pupil attainment. Responsible for teaching a mixed ability class of 18 boys, the successful applicant will need to hold a recognised teaching qualification (BA(Ed), BEd or PGCE) and have proven experience of teaching in Key Stage 1. In return, we offer excellent facilities and resources, combined with a competitive salary. We are a boys' preparatory school (ages 4-13) in Wimbledon (over 280 pupils). Willington Prep

Based in the heart of Wimbledon, Willington Prep offers an education for life for girls and boys aged 3 to 11. It is an exciting time to be at Willington as we move, after 135 years of being an all boys school, to become a fully co-educational school.

Welcoming girls into this fantastic learning community makes Willington a truly family friendly school. Offering a high quality education to all, where pupils are self-confident and happy, we instil the values of kindness, humility, respect and honesty in all that we do.

Our quietly confident Year 6 pupils go on to a vast range of destination schools, many with scholarships from academic and sport through to music and art. A broad curriculum and rich co-curricular programme is offered from Nursery onwards, led by passionate, supportive teachers, who hold true to the school's motto, non scholae sed vitae discimus - we do not learn for school, but for life.
